My wife was diagnosed with Papillary thyroid cancer. Thyroid was removed and iodine therapy was done.
Now after 6 months we have done TG test. I have attached the file. Please let me know if the cancer still exist or no

you have completed the intended treatement for pap thyroid cancer - total thyroidectomy followed by radioiodine therapy. Wish to know your biopsy report to understand tumour better. However..
The blood report you shared shows a good result,
But Complete information to understand you are disease free at the moment will include few more reports though
1. Serum Anti Thyroglobulin(Tg) antibody levels (need to look at trend of this too just like thyroglobulin report)
2. Followup radioiodine scan (done at 6 months post iodine therapy)
3. Ultrasound neck/thyroid
4. Serum TSH levels
If all normal on reports and by examination, you can stay relaxed but do continue followup atleast 3-6 monthly for next 2 years with Ultrasound and blood tests (Tg, anti-tg, tsh levels), and only if necessary radioiodine scan
